Output e78a465617b91acfef332b54a8c0b8354749373aa2e4dd0093ef83ddd83c0088:0

value
24902203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de40252573b3359734523bf2c4d33941153fdca OP_EQUAL
address
32xTrPJiRhjYFEyvtbvsqYjsAkZBnzPNBA
transaction
e78a465617b91acfef332b54a8c0b8354749373aa2e4dd0093ef83ddd83c0088
spent
true